Stefano Cataloni BA, GRDip, MM, FHEA

Senior Tutor

School of Management

My teaching and research interests are in international business, leadership, and organisational behaviour. My current research is on leadership and the impact it has on the psychosocial safety climate within an organisation. Before working at Massey, I held a variety of roles in the private and public sectors; experiences which I like to regularly incorporate into my teaching and research practice. I enjoy interacting with students in small and large settings, and welcome discussions in lectures and workshops.
